# **Caddy WAF, Prometheus and Grafana**
|
|
|
|
Monitor your **caddy-waf** performance and security in real-time with **Prometheus** and **Grafana**. Track key metrics like allowed/blocked requests, rule hits (e.g., "block-scanners", "sql-injection", "xss-attacks", browser integrity checks), and more, to understand your WAF's effectiveness against threats.
|
|
|
|
This guide helps you create a **Prometheus exporter** to bridge Caddy WAF's JSON metrics (from `/waf_metrics`) to Prometheus's format. You'll then visualize these metrics in Grafana dashboards for actionable insights.
|
|
|
|
### **Step 1: Set Up Your Environment**
|
|
|
|
1. **Install Python**: Get Python 3.x from [python.org](https://www.python.org/).
|
|
|
|
2. **Install Libraries**:
|
|
```bash
|
|
pip install prometheus-client requests
|
|
```
|
|
|
|
### **Step 2: Create the Exporter Script (exporter.py)**
|
|
|
|
```python
|
|
from prometheus_client import start_http_server, Counter, Gauge
|
|
import requests
|
|
import time
|
|
import json
|
|
|
|
# Define Prometheus metrics
|
|
TOTAL_REQUESTS = Counter('caddywaf_total_requests', 'Total requests processed')
|
|
BLOCKED_REQUESTS = Counter('caddywaf_blocked_requests', 'Total requests blocked')
|
|
ALLOWED_REQUESTS = Counter('caddywaf_allowed_requests', 'Total requests allowed')
|
|
RULE_HITS = Counter('caddywaf_rule_hits', 'Hits per WAF rule', ['rule_id'])
|
|
RULE_HITS_BY_PHASE = Counter('caddywaf_rule_hits_by_phase', 'Rule hits by phase', ['phase'])
|
|
DNS_BLACKLIST_HITS = Counter('caddywaf_dns_blacklist_hits', 'DNS blacklist hits')
|
|
GEOIP_BLOCKED = Counter('caddywaf_geoip_blocked', 'Blocked by GeoIP')
|
|
IP_BLACKLIST_HITS = Counter('caddywaf_ip_blacklist_hits', 'IP blacklist hits')
|
|
RATE_LIMITER_BLOCKED_REQUESTS = Counter('caddywaf_rate_limiter_blocked_requests', 'Rate limiter blocked')
|
|
RATE_LIMITER_REQUESTS = Counter('caddywaf_rate_limiter_requests', 'Rate limiter requests')
|
|
WAF_VERSION = Gauge('caddywaf_version', 'WAF version', ['version'])
|
|
|
|
def fetch_metrics():
|
|
try:
|
|
response = requests.get("http://localhost:8080/waf_metrics")
|
|
response.raise_for_status()
|
|
data = response.json()
|
|
|
|
TOTAL_REQUESTS.inc(data["total_requests"])
|
|
BLOCKED_REQUESTS.inc(data["blocked_requests"])
|
|
ALLOWED_REQUESTS.inc(data["allowed_requests"])
|
|
DNS_BLACKLIST_HITS.inc(data["dns_blacklist_hits"])
|
|
GEOIP_BLOCKED.inc(data["geoip_blocked"])
|
|
IP_BLACKLIST_HITS.inc(data["ip_blacklist_hits"])
|
|
RATE_LIMITER_BLOCKED_REQUESTS.inc(data["rate_limiter_blocked_requests"])
|
|
RATE_LIMITER_REQUESTS.inc(data["rate_limiter_requests"])
|
|
WAF_VERSION.labels(version=data["version"]).set(1)
|
|
|
|
for rule_id, hits in data["rule_hits"].items():
|
|
RULE_HITS.labels(rule_id=rule_id).inc(hits)
|
|
|
|
if "rule_hits_by_phase" in data:
|
|
for phase, hits in data["rule_hits_by_phase"].items():
|
|
RULE_HITS_BY_PHASE.labels(phase=phase).inc(hits)
|
|
|
|
except requests.exceptions.RequestException as e:
|
|
print(f"Error fetching metrics: {e}")
|
|
except json.JSONDecodeError as e:
|
|
print(f"JSON Decode Error: {e}")
|
|
|
|
if __name__ == '__main__':
|
|
start_http_server(8000)
|
|
print("Exporter started on http://localhost:8000/metrics")
|
|
while True:
|
|
fetch_metrics()
|
|
time.sleep(10)
|
|
```
|
|
|
|
### **Step 3: Run the Exporter**
|
|
|
|
1. Start: `python exporter.py`
|
|
2. Verify: `http://localhost:8000/metrics` in browser. Check for Prometheus format.
|
|
|
|
Example output snippet:
|
|
```
|
|
# HELP caddywaf_rule_hits_by_phase Rule hits by phase
|
|
# TYPE caddywaf_rule_hits_by_phase counter
|
|
caddywaf_rule_hits_by_phase{phase="1"} 1461
|
|
caddywaf_rule_hits_by_phase{phase="2"} 705
|
|
```
|
|
|
|
### **Step 4: Configure Prometheus**
|
|
|
|
1. Install: [prometheus.io/download/](https://prometheus.io/download/)
|
|
2. Edit `prometheus.yml`:
|
|
|
|
```yaml
|
|
scrape_configs:
|
|
- job_name: 'caddywaf_exporter'
|
|
static_configs:
|
|
- targets: ['localhost:8000']
|
|
```
|
|
|
|
3. Start: `./prometheus --config.file=prometheus.yml`
|
|
4. Verify: Prometheus UI (`http://localhost:9090`) > Status > Targets > `caddywaf_exporter` should be UP.

### **Step 5: Set Up Grafana**
|
|
|
|
1. Install: [grafana.com/grafana/download](https://grafana.com/grafana/download)
|
|
2. Start: `http://localhost:3000` (login: `admin/admin`)
|
|
3. Add Data Source: Configuration > Data Sources > Add data source > Prometheus. URL: `http://localhost:9090`. Save & Test.
|
|
4. Create Dashboard: Create > Dashboard > Add panel. Example queries:
|
|
|
|
* **Total Requests:** `sum(rate(caddywaf_total_requests[1m]))`
|
|
* **Blocked Requests:** `sum(rate(caddywaf_blocked_requests[1m]))`
|
|
* **Top Rule Hits:** `topk(10, sum by (rule_id) (rate(caddywaf_rule_hits[1m])))`
|
|
* **Rule Hits by Phase:** `sum by (phase) (rate(caddywaf_rule_hits_by_phase[1m]))`
|
|
* **WAF Version:** `caddywaf_version`
|
|
|
|
Customize dashboards as needed.
|
|
|
|
### **Step 6: Run Everything Together**
|
|
|
|
1. Start Caddy WAF (`/waf_metrics` accessible).
|
|
2. Start Exporter: `python exporter.py`
|
|
3. Start Prometheus (with config).
|
|
4. Start Grafana (connected to Prometheus).
|
|
5. Visualize metrics in Grafana.

### **Optional: Exporter as Service (systemd)**
|
|
|
|
1. Create: `sudo nano /etc/systemd/system/caddywaf-exporter.service`
|
|
|
|
2. Content:
|
|
```ini
|
|
[Unit]
|
|
Description=Caddy WAF Prometheus Exporter
|
|
After=network.target
|
|
|
|
[Service]
|
|
User=your_user
|
|
ExecStart=/usr/bin/python3 /path/to/exporter.py
|
|
Restart=always
|
|
|
|
[Install]
|
|
WantedBy=multi-user.target
|
|
```
|
|
|
|
3. Run:
|
|
```bash
|
|
sudo systemctl daemon-reload
|
|
sudo systemctl start caddywaf-exporter
|
|
sudo systemctl enable caddywaf-exporter
|
|
```
|
|
|
|
4. Verify: `sudo systemctl status caddywaf-exporter`
